Search jobs > Toronto, ON > Data engineer

Data Engineer

Joyride
Toronto, Ontario, Canada
$70K-$95K a year (estimated)
Full-time

Who we are

Joyride is the world's leading SaaS platform for micromobility, enabling businesses around the globe to launch, manage and grow their own branded fleets of bikes, scooters, mopeds and everything else smaller than a car.

We are passionate about transportation and changing the way people think about community connectivity. At Joyride, you'll get to work with a motivated and driven team to find creative solutions to exciting challenges in a rapidly evolving, fast-paced industry.

Job Overview :

We are seeking a highly skilled and experienced Data Engineer to join our team. As a Data Engineer, you will be responsible for handling a large volume of data from back-end apis, mobile applications and IoT devices.

Your primary responsibility will be creating meaningful insights from this data, developing and training machine learning models, and ensuring the efficient flow of data stored in multiple data storage systems such as MySQL, PostgreSQL, and Google BigQuery.

Key responsibilities include but are not limited to :

  • Create and maintain machine learning models that can provide useful predictions and insight
  • Design and develop scalable data processing pipelines that can handle large volumes of data from multiple data source.
  • Develop and implement data storage and retrieval strategies that are efficient and scalable.
  • Create and maintain databases using technologies like MySQL, PostgreSQL, and Google BigQuery.
  • Implement and maintain data integration workflows between various data storage systems.
  • Monitor and optimize the performance of data processing pipelines, databases, and machine learning models.
  • Ensure the security and privacy of data by implementing appropriate access controls and encryption measures.
  • Collaborate with other teams to understand their data requirements and provide solutions that meet their needs.

Desired qualifications

  • Bachelor's or Master's degree in Computer Science, Data Science, or a related field.
  • 5+ years of experience in a similar role.
  • Experience in handling large volumes of data, preferentially from IoT devices.
  • Experience in working with geospatial data and analyzing them at large scale.
  • Strong programming skills in languages like Python, Java, and Scala.
  • Strong experience in data storage and retrieval using technologies like MySQL, PostgreSQL, and Google BigQuery.
  • Experience in designing and developing scalable data processing pipelines using technologies like Apache Spark, Apache Flink, or Kafka.
  • Strong understanding of machine learning concepts and experience in developing and training machine learning models.
  • Experience in implementing and maintaining data integration workflows between various data storage systems.
  • Experience working with different cloud providers such as AWS, GCP and Azure.
  • Strong problem-solving skills and attention to detail.
  • Excellent communication and collaboration skills.

Working conditions :

  • Health & Dental Insurance
  • Hybrid office schedule
  • Head office conveniently located close to Union Station
  • ESOP
  • Micromobility perks
  • 30+ days ago
Related jobs
0000050007 Royal Bank of Canada
Toronto, Ontario

Big Data Management, Cloud Computing, Database Development, Data Mining, Data Warehousing (DW), ETL Processing, Group Problem Solving, Quality Management, Requirements Analysis. We are seeking for a highly skilled Data Engineer to join our team and work on building Data Monetization products. Knowle...

Scotiabank
Toronto, Ontario

The Global Engineering and Operations Functions (GEOF) is seeking an experienced Data Engineer who specializes in several development stages of SDLC. Must have extensive (5+ years) hands on technical working experience programming using Tools: ETL tools: Python, Spark, DataStage Exposure to working ...

Morningstar
Toronto, Ontario

The QA Engineer is expected to improve the accuracy of Corporate System Dataand improve stability of data ingestion pipelines. We are looking for aSenior Data Quality Engineerto join the Central Technology Product Development team in support of Morningstar’s Business Intelligence Reporting. At our c...

RAPS Consulting Inc
Mississauga, Ontario

We are seeking an experienced Data Engineer with a strong background in Snowflake and SQL to join our technology team. The ideal candidate will be responsible for developing, optimizing, and maintaining our Snowflake data warehouse environment to support financial data analysis and reporting needs. ...

Lime
Canada

The Data Engineering team at Lime is responsible for ingesting, transforming and making available timely, high-quality data that powers analytics, bookkeeping and visibility for a wide range of customers. Implement data governance policies and ensure data security and compliance. You have a strong d...

Deloitte
Toronto, Ontario

Data literacy: finding and managing data, cleansing data, manipulating data. As a Data Privacy Engineer, you will be at the forefront of Deloitte's mission to ensure data privacy and protection. Responsible for assisting with the management of the data privacy, data protection, data usability, perfo...

Movable Ink
Toronto, Ontario

As a Principal Data Engineer you will help drive the direction of our Data Warehouse. Design, implement, and maintain robust data pipelines that feed data into our Data Platform, ensuring high performance, scalability, and reliability. Data Engineer with a focus on cloud-based Data Warehouse platfor...

Astra North Infoteck Inc.
Mississauga, Ontario

Role: Java Full stack Developer + Data Engineer. Combination of Data Engineer and Java Fullstack Dev API, AWS, Kubernetes, API, No SQL. Experience with database technologies like Snowflake (must have), Postgres and PL SQL (must have). ...

E-Solutions
Toronto, Ontario

AWS ETL Data Engineer (Amazon Redshift ). Design, develop, and maintain ETL processes using AWS Glue to extract, transform, and load data from various sources (including S, ORC/Parquet/Text files) into AWS Redshift. Transform, clean, and preprocess data from various sources to load into Redshift and...

Lyons Consulting Group
Toronto, Ontario

Senior Data Engineer - DataBricks-. Develop and manage frameworks for data ingestion and workflow orchestration using Data Factory or Dataflows. Hands-on experience with Azure Data Factory, Azure Databricks, Azure Synapse Analytics, and other Azure data services. Fabric Analytics Engineer Associate ...